Grambling. They were supposed to come here on september 1, but USC asked us to come this year instead of 2019. Hard to pass up when we’re being paid $1.4M to travel to Watts. I guess we made it work with them. Now we have Grambling, UTEP at home, and Arkansas State on the road. We can add a 13th game if we want. I’m not sure what the staff will do. I wouldn’t mind another home game if the team is right.
